by either Camino Del Cerro or Grant Rd. Christopher Columbus Park is the is the Contest Site for the Vingage Stunt Championships (VSC).
The Cholla Choppers and the Central Arizona Control Line Club (see logos below) together run and manage VSC.
March 12th thru 15th, 2008 will be the 20th running of the Vintage Stunt Championships.

Item #1: During the two days of Old Time and Old Time Ignition the two unused circles will be reserved for Old Time Practice until 11:30AM. No Classic practice flights until 11:30AM
for the first two days of competition unless the ignition stunt competition finishes early. If the ignition stunt competition finishes early (before 11:30AM), then the circle is available
for practice flights by any and all competitors. During the competition Friday and Saturday, the three unused circles will be open for practice both days (no restrictions).
Item #2: The Classic pilots meeting will take place at 6:45AM both days with official flying starting at 7:15AM. The flight order for Classic will be posted at appearance judging Thursday
March 13th.
